Japanese schoolgirl signs pro contractpublished about 7 hours ago
Eri Yoshida, a 16-year-old Japanese girl signed with a regional baseball team Tuesday, becoming the country's first female professional baseball player.

Phelps named top sportsman by Sports Illustratedpublished about 7 hours ago
Michael Phelps achieved another unprecedented feat: the first swimmer honored as Sports Illustrated's sportsman of the year.
